现在我们已经安装好了Ubuntu Server,作为一台Server服务器,我们通常使用ssh来远程连接它,进而管理、使用它。
SSH是一种网络协议,用于计算机之间的加密登录。如果一个用户从本地计算机,使用SSH协议登录另一台远程计算机,我们就可以认为,这种登录是安全的,即使被中途截获,密码也不会泄露。最早的时候,互联网通信都是明文通信,一旦被截获,内容就暴露无疑。1995年,芬兰学者Tatu Ylonen设计了SSH协议,将登录信息全部加密,成为互联网安全的一个基本解决方案,迅速在全世界获得推广,目前已经成为Linux系统的标准配置。
1、准备SSH客户端软件
这里推荐两个可以免费使用的软件:
MobaXterm
MobaXterm 分免费开源版和收费专业版。官网提供 MobaXterm 的免费开源版 "Home Edition" 下载, 免费开源版又分便捷版(解压即用)和安装版(需要一步步安装)。MobaXterm 免费版(persional)和专业版(Professional)除了 sessions 数、SSH tunnels 数和其他一些定制化配置外限制外,免费版在终端底部还多了一个 "UNREGISTERED VERSION" 提示。
NxShell
NxShell,一款跨平台的SSH免费终端软件,linux远程连接工具,免费ssh客户端、主机服务器远程管理客户端。支持SSH/Sftp协议,支持会话管理器,多选项卡管理主机导入和导出功能,支持ssh隧道socksv5,当前开启后默认监听在localhost:10080;支持ssh rz/sz命令文件上传下载,轻松管理远程服务器文件。
2、连接Ubuntu Server
这里以NxShell为例:
点击“+”图标添加服务器配置:
将认证方式改为‘密码’,输入主机名称、主机地址、用户名、密码,点击保存或者保存并连接即可。